		<description>The Honorable Senator Dodd/The Honorable Senator Shelby
Dear Senator Dodd/Dear Senator Shelby, 
I am writing to encourage you and the members of the Senate Banking Committee to pass an effective financial reform bill and establish a Consumer Financial Protection Agency. The CFPA must be an independent agency that will stand up for every America consumer and crack down on abusive practices by credit card companies and mortgage lenders. We need a strong agency, not a watered-down version, nor one that will wield no real power because it is buried in another department or agency. A strong CFPA will also limit the kinds of risk that led to the current crisis, hold Wall Street accountable, and, as a result, prevent future financial meltdowns.
Senators Dodd and Shelby, you have been charged with representing the interests of the American public. Please be visionary leaders and champions. Be OUR voices in Congress, not those of the big banks, CEOs and Wall Street institutions responsible for the financial collapse that has cost millions of jobs and devastated so many lives and communities. We need a Consumer Financial Protection Agency, and we need meaningful financial reform.

Respectfully,  Rashelle Walker- consumer, and proud American
